
April 26, 1999
CARDINAL BEVILACQUA TO CELEBRATE
MASS FOR PERSONS WITH DISABILITIES
Anthony Cardinal Bevilacqua, Archbishop of Philadelphia, will celebrate the Mass for Persons with Disabilities Sunday, May 2, 1999.
2:00 p.m.
Cathedral Basilica of Saints Peter and Paul
18th Street and Benjamin Franklin Parkway
Philadelphia
Approximately 900 people from the disabled community, along with the family and friends, are expected to attend this special Mass. People with disabilities will participate in the liturgy as altar servers, lectors and in the offertory procession.
Reverend James P. Bradley from the Office for Disabled Persons in the Diocese of Brooklyn will be the homilist.
